Title
A combinatorial 3-coordinate system for the face centered cubic grid

Abstract
A new combinatorial 3-coordinate system for cells in the face centered cubic grid is presented, and some of its properties are detailed. Three independent coordinates are used to address the voxels (rhombic dodecahedra), their faces (rhombs), their edges and the points at their corners. The incidence (boundary and co-boundary) and adjacency relations between the cells can easily be captured by these coordinate values. The new coordinate system can effectively by applied in various image processing morphological and topological operations.
